Apache での PHP5 の 2 つのインストール モード

WBOY
リリース: 2016-06-13 12:46:51
オリジナル
1140 人が閲覧しました

PHP 5.0.0 と PHP 4.0.38 は、2004 年 7 月 13 日に同時にリリースされました。これは、PHP 愛好家にとって素晴らしいニュースです。待望のPHP5がついにリリースされ、PHPの新機能や使う・開発する楽しさをさらに楽しめるようになりました。

私も初めて PHP5 を使用しましたが、PHP を愛する友人と共有するために、私のインストール プロセス (Apache サーバーでのインストールのみ) を簡単に紹介します。

実際、PHP5 のインストールプロセスには新しいものはなく、PHP4 と似ています。

1. CGI モード

1. php-5.0.0-Win32.zip を x:php に解凍し、php.ini-dist の名前を php.ini に変更して、x:winnt (x:windows) または Apache インストール フォルダーにコピーします。 x:phpphp5ts.dll を winnt (windows)、winntsystem32、または apache のインストール フォルダーにコピーします。

2. Apache の httpd.conf ファイルを変更します。次の行を追加します:
ScriptAlias /php/ "x:/php/"
AddType application/x-httpd-php .php
Action application/x-httpd-php "/php/php -cgi.exe"

3. php.ini を変更します。 cgi.force_redirect = 0 を設定します


2. モジュールアプローチ

1. 上記 1 に同じ。

2. 上記2を次のように変更します。
LoadModule php5_module php5apache.dll
AddModule mod_php5.c
AddType application/x-httpd-php .php

上記のステップ 3 は実行しないでください

注: Apache2 の場合、上記の AddModule mod_php5.c を http.conf に追加する必要はありません。


3. モジュールの拡張

以上で基本的にインストールは完了ですが、拡張機能を使用する場合は再度設定が必要です。たとえばmysqlを使用します。

1. php.ini を設定します。通常、「include_path =」と「extension_dir =」を設定する必要があります。特に後者は、パスがカスタマイズされており、通常は少なくとも x:php と x:phpext を含みます。 「extension=」を設定するには、通常、直前の「;」記号を削除します。

2. 対応する dll ファイルを winnt (windows)、winntsystem32、または apache のインストール フォルダーにコピーします。

mysql のロードを例として説明します。php.ini を変更し、extension_dir = "x:phpext" を設定し、extension=php_mysql.dll の前の「;」を削除し、x:phplibmysql.dll を winnt (Windows) にコピーします。 )、または winntsystem32、または Apache のインストール フォルダー。

設定または変更を有効にするには、いつでも Web サーバーを再起動する必要があることに注意してください。すべてのphp4プログラムを実行できます。上記のパスの x はパーティションを表します。ご自身で置き換えてください。

win2k と apache1.3.31 にインストールしました。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のおすすめ
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ート